30103024 has 20 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 66656944. Its totient is φ = 12901248.
The previous prime is 30103019. The next prime is 30103027. The reversal of 30103024 is 42030103.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 30102995 and 30103013.
It is a congruent number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(30103027)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 134277 + ... + 134500.
Almost surely, 230103024 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
30103024 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(36553920).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
30103024 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
30103024 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 268792 (or 268786 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 72, while the sum is 13.
The square root of 30103024 is about 5486.6222760456. The cubic root of 30103024 is about 311.0785325674.
Adding to 30103024 its reverse (42030103), we get a palindrome (72133127).
The spelling of 30103024 in words is "thirty million, one hundred three thousand, twenty-four".
